About Abdolreza Daraei

Abdolreza Daraei is a scholar working on Cancer Research, Molecular Biology and Oncology, having authored 52 papers that have together received 739 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Cancer-related molecular mechanisms research (26 papers), Circular RNAs in diseases (22 papers) and MicroRNA in disease regulation (21 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Cancer Research (464 citations), Molecular Biology (541 citations) and Genetics (72 citations). Abdolreza Daraei has collaborated with scholars based in Iran, Italy and United States. Frequent co-authors include Yaser Mansoori, Javad Tavakkoly‐Bazzaz, Rasoul Abdollahzadeh, Mahsa M. Amoli, Milad Bastami, Ziba Nariman‐Saleh‐Fam, Rasoul Salehi, Zahra Saadatian, Mohammad Mehdi Naghizadeh and Sepideh Zununi Vahed. Their work appears in journ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Scientific Reports and International Journal of Molecular Sciences.
